Beginners keen to enter the field of underground services can benefit from courses such as Identify, Locate and Protect Underground Services RIICCM202E, Work as a Safety Observer/Spotter RIIRTM203E, and Fabricate, Assemble and Dismantle Utilities Industry Components UEECD0019. These qualifications provide a solid foundation for those entering the industry without prior experience, making it easier to step into roles such as a Land Surveyor or Surveyor Assistant in the Bathurst area.
For individuals with prior experience looking to advance their careers, the Certificate IV in Surveying and Spatial Information Services CPP41721 is an exceptional option.
